Introduction to Composting

Composting is the process of breaking down organic materials, such as kitchen scraps, yard waste, and plant residues, into a dark, crumbly substance called compost. This process is carried out by microorganisms, such as bacteria, fungi, and other decomposers, which feed on the organic matter and convert it into compost.

Composting can take place in different types of systems, including compost bins, piles, or tumblers. The choice of system depends on available space, time, and personal preferences. It's important to have a good mixture of “green” nitrogen-rich materials (e.g., fruit peels, grass clippings) and “brown” carbon-rich materials (e.g., leaves, straw) to create an optimal composting environment.

By composting, organic gardeners can reduce the amount of waste going to landfills and, instead, create a valuable resource for their gardens.

The Benefits of Composting in Organic Gardening

Integrating composting into organic gardening practices provides numerous benefits:

  • Improved Soil Health: Compost is a natural fertilizer and soil amendment that improves soil structure, moisture retention, and nutrient availability. It enhances the overall health of the soil, providing a fertile environment for plant growth.
  • Nutrient Recycling: Composting allows for the recycling of nutrients from organic waste. Rather than throwing away valuable nutrients, they are returned to the garden, enriching the soil and reducing the need for synthetic fertilizers.
  • Reduced Environmental Impact: By composting organic waste, gardeners can reduce the release of greenhouse gases in landfills. Composting also helps conserve water, prevent soil erosion, and promote biodiversity.
  • Cost Savings: By producing compost at home, organic gardeners can save money on purchasing commercial fertilizers and soil amendments. Compost can be used as a free, natural alternative to synthetic products.
  • Plant Disease Suppression: Compost contains beneficial microorganisms that can help suppress plant diseases and pests. The diverse microbial community in compost contributes to a healthier and more resilient garden ecosystem.

Integrating Composting into Organic Gardening Practices

To integrate composting into organic gardening, the following practices can be adopted:

  1. Collecting and Sorting Organic Waste: Start by setting up a collection system for organic waste, including kitchen scraps, yard trimmings, and plant residues. Separate them into “green” and “brown” materials for an optimal composting mix.
  2. Building or Purchasing a Compost Bin: Choose a suitable composting system, such as a bin or tumbler, depending on available space and aesthetic preferences. Consider factors like airflow, drainage, and accessibility when building or purchasing a composting container.
  3. Layering and Turning: To speed up the composting process, create layers of “green” and “brown” materials in the compost bin. Periodically turn the pile to introduce oxygen, promote decomposition, and prevent odors.
  4. Maintaining Moisture and Temperature: Composting requires a balance of moisture and temperature. Keep the compost pile consistently moist, but not soggy. Monitor the internal temperature, aiming for a range of 110-160°F (43-71°C) for proper decomposition.
  5. Avoiding Meat, Dairy, and Oily Materials: It is recommended to exclude meat, dairy products, and oily materials from the compost pile, as they can attract pests and take a longer time to break down.
  6. Using the Finished Compost: When the compost is fully decomposed and transformed into dark, earthy-smelling humus, it is ready to be used in the garden. Apply it as a topdressing, incorporate it into the soil, or use it as potting mix for container plants.
